Jordan did not disappoint. Having two full days in Petra allowed good exploration. This included a visit to little Petra. Make sure you go to the Monastery. It’s well worth all the steps. A night in Wadi Rum was enjoyable. Cold in December but plenty of blankets. No one had to use the communal tent. We were the only group at the camp. This may not always be the case. The optional camel ride is fun and I’d recommend it. The jeep rides are bumpy but again good fun and the only way to take in the vast scenery. Make sure you embrace the mud at the Dead Sea. The hotels were all very good. Buffet breakfasts. Food at Wadi Rum was particularly good. Restaurant meals for dinner were about 15 dinar (including drinks). Food good and plentiful. The bus was a little cramped for 15 of us but the driver was excellent and very safe. The guide was very good and passionate about his country. He knows everyone. Jordan felt very safe. An Explore representative meets you in the airport and takes you through immigration. We were lucky with good weather. Sunny and dry all week. Good group of people to share this experience with. I would definitely recommend this trip.
